Little Hawks Foundation NPO began in a Rocklands kitchen — and in the heart of one woman determined that no child in her community would go to school hungry.

Little Hawks Foundation is a non-profit organisation that founder Noleen Fisher started to aid families who are hungry, struggling and impoverished in her community. She also assists unemployed community members seeking jobs — typing CVs free of charge — and helps with copies of important documents needed for SASSA, or for seniors needing rates papers and IDs copied at no cost.

From the NPO in Rocklands, Noleen prepares breakfast sandwiches for children aged 4–16, as well as for moms and grandparents who have nothing to eat before going to school and work. Sandwiches are also provided for lunch throughout the day, and many evenings — for families who would otherwise have nothing.

Mitchells Plain is overrun with drugs and crime, which has broken up many homes and families. Gangsterism is at an all-time high, which means children are often hungry, malnourished, and in desperate need of care as many parents are consumed by addiction.

The current means of providing meals is funded through Noleen's real estate work. School shoes, bags, stationery and warm winter clothing are bought out of her own pocket. Through partnered attorneys, the Foundation also arranges free wills and legal guidance for community members who can't afford an attorney.

Our intention with Little Hawks Foundation is to break the cycle of poverty, violence, and limited opportunities by providing essential resources, educational programs, and a strong support system. More than 70 children come to the Foundation every single day.
